Description

The F9 is the most understable fairway driver available from Prodigy Disc. Designed for beginners or players with lower arm speed to be able to get a disc to hyzerflip or have very little low-speed fade, this fairway driver is also a great disc for players learning how to throw a roller.

The F9 has a smaller rim width which helps players with smaller hands grip the disc better. For children and beginners, the F9 can be a maximum distance driver that produces a full-flex S-curve flight at a low speed. More experienced players can also throw low-effort turnover shots to easily bend the disc around a corner.

400 Plastic is a premium blend of materials that is extremely durable and gives the thrower an impeccable grip, even when it is wet. It is the most popular Prodigy plastic across the entire lineup of discs. While 400 Plastic is often known for its translucent properties, which catch the sunlight well for pronounced colors in the daytime, it can also be more opaque. 400 plastic has a stiff rim and more “pop” when you flex the center of the disc.
